Alexander Names Leadership for Third Senate Bid
By The Associated Press and Whitney Jones
Republican U.S. Sen. Lamar Alexander has announced the leadership team for his 2014 re-election campaign, dispelling speculation the 72-year-old is nearing retirement. U.S. Rep. John Duncan will serve as Alexander’s campaign chairman. Gov. Bill Haslam, Sen. Bob Corker, state Senate Speaker Ron Ramsey and House Speaker Beth Harwell are all honorary co-chairs.
If Alexander wins it will be his third term in the Senate. He has also served twice as governor, president of the University of Tennessee and U.S. secretary of education.
